What does an adaptive ski instructor do?

Career: Adaptive Ski Instructor

An Adaptive Ski Instructor teaches skiing to individuals with disabilities, using specialized techniques and equipment to accommodate various physical, cognitive, and sensory needs. They tailor lessons to each student’s abilities,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ience on the slopes. Instructors may work with adaptive gear like sit-skis, outriggers, or tethers to assist skiers with mobility or balance challenges. Their goal is to promote independence, confidence, and a love for skiing among all participants.
